This hit Japanese anime series is the brainchild of mecha designer Shoji Kawamori. Renton is an ordinary boy with a less-than-thrilling life. But when a colossal robot contraption lands in his living room, things get a lot more exciting. With a girl named Eureka captaining the ship, Renton enters a world of high-stakes drama. The adventures continue with this fifth volume of episodes.

...This 3 pack DVD has two great blockbusters from the Golden era namely Chhalia (1960)and China Town(1962), although the other film Dayar-E-Madina , a muslim social relatively little known..
Chhalia has an impressive star cast of Raj Kapoor, Nutan, Rehman and Pran ,and an equally impressive music score by composers Kalyanji Anandji.
Chhalia is by no means one of Nutan's best films, in fact it compares poorly with the Raj kapoor-Nutan starrer 'Anadi' ...the story line is a bit complicated at times, with too many twists and turns...but the music is pleasing especially Mukesh songs'Dum dum diga diga ' 'Chalia mera naam and 'Mere toote hue dil mein.. and Lata's 'Tere rahon mein khade hai ' and 'Baje paayal cham cham'....worth watching a great actress like Nutan in any film, and picturisation of the melodious songs...
